анреал и Spectaculator не грузят эту тапку после выбора любого языка
а вот подключенный образ в ПрофПЗУ загружает, кроме русского, но там похоже в русской версии косяк с именами файлов
- - - Добавлено - - -
в эмуляторе работает?
Вид для печати
А можно еще такую хотелку - когда заходишь в подменю в теневике, то он сам включает турбу и назад не выключает. Можно сделать чтобы выключал, если до этого была выключена (или как вариант - устанавливал то что выбрано в V. Computer speed)?
marinovsoft, Пока нет возможности работать с реалом, а на эмуле это не отлаживается.
Как я понимаю, вы имеете ввиду корректное восстановление режима "турбо" при выходе из монитора?
Не при выходе, а прямо в нем самом. Заходишь в какой-нибудь пункт меню - турба включилась.
В unreal speccy jn tsl можно поставить бряк на запись в порт
https://i.ibb.co/HBwcJ6t/in7ffd.png
И при срабатывании попадаем сюда, в этом месте должна происходить какая-то магия, но она похоже поломалась.
https://i.ibb.co/hFyx1vB/7ffd.png
Я эту штуку еще несколько лет назад проверял https://zx-pk.ru/threads/29860-glyuchit-skorpion.html
как я понимаю, это так и задумывалось разработчиками
При входе в монитор по NMI определяется режим турбо/нормальный, в самом мониторе турбо включается, при выходе из монитора восстанавливается та скорость что была при входе.
С rst 8 чуть по другому. При вызове rst 8, скорость не определяется, а при выходе из монитора включается тот режим который задан в настройке V. Computer speed
Задумывалось то это да, но вот логика работы не очень. Пусть она включается только при входе, а если руками отключаем, то и остается отключенной (или включается-выключается только на время выполнения операций, требующих более высокой производительности).
В общем, методом перебора сделал так, чтобы при манипуляциях в теневике включался тот режим, который выбран в пункте V. Computer speed. Это не то, что я в конечном итоге хочу, но по-другому я навряд ли сумею сделать.
Патч адрес: было стало
Код:00014FD2: EB E4
небольшая обнова
- в меню O. Other Settings добавлена опция T. Turbo HIGH
- добавлено меню дополнительных опций. вызов cs+1(EDIT) в главном меню basic128
- исправлен загрузчик .spg файлов
- несколько изменена и расширена работа функции rst 8: db #8B
- написан навигатор, что-то типа небольшого бута, для выбора и загрузки программ (вызывать можно как из монитора, так и из меню basic128, оперативную память не использует)
первый пост обновил
с mfs-разделами выдает ошибку:
https://i.postimg.cc/prCYS9zq/sshot-000000.png
а в остальном - огонь!